Overview

A silver 1 Pound non-circulating commemorative coin of the United Kingdom, issued in 2020 for the Music Legends series dedicated to David Bowie. The obverse features the fifth crowned portrait of Queen Elizabeth II by Jody Clark. The reverse displays an image of David Bowie with stars and a lightning bolt, also designed by Jody Clark. This is a Proof strike piece composed of .999 silver, weighing 15.71 grams with a 27 mm diameter. Struck as Proof.

Design details

Obverse

Fifth crowned portrait of Queen Elizabeth II right, wearing the George IV State Diadem, legend around.

Reverse

An image of David Bowie, with stars left, lightning bolt behind, legend right
